Doing business here

Economic development contacts, most local first:

city Arvada Economic Development Association
The Arvada Economic Development Association (AEDA) provides business and commercial development services to new and existing businesses to help them grow and expand, create jobs, increase revenues, and make capital investments. It partners with the City of Arvada and uses demographic, financial, business, and consumer research to support a competitive business community.
county Adams County Regional Economic Partnership
AC-REP is the regional chamber and economic development organization for the Greater Adams County area, dedicated to advancing the success of local businesses and communities. It aims to amplify the region's business story, champion workforce development, and drive priorities in energy, housing, and transportation.
state Colorado Economic Development
The Colorado Office of Economic Development and International Trade promotes economic growth and long-term job creation by supporting small businesses and encouraging business expansion across Colorado, and champions industries like the creative industries, outdoor recreation, and tourism.
